Job Description

A part-time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) position is available for the 2026/2027 school year, working with a high school caseload. This contract role offers approximately 8 hours per week, ideal for professionals seeking a focused and impactful experience in the educational setting. Located in New Haven, CT, this opportunity involves providing speech-language services to high school students, supporting their communication development and academic success. Key responsibilities include: Conducting speech and language evaluations for high school students Developing and implementing individualized treatment plans Collaborating with educators and families to support student progress Utilizing clinical skills in both direct therapy and consultative roles Preferred qualifications and experience: Certification as a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) Experience working with pediatric and adolescent populations Familiarity with school-based therapy environments Teletherapy experience is a plus Completion of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) preferred but not mandatory Ability to manage a high school-level caseload effectively The contract will run from August 31, 2026, through June 14, 2027, providing consistent hours throughout the academic year. This role is well-suited for SLPs interested in school-based practice who enjoy working with teens and wish to contribute to their communication development during critical educational years.
